Navy Survey to Address Privatized Housing Issues

By Commander, Navy Installations Command Public Affairs

As a result of recent concerns of sub-standard privatized housing conditions across the military branches, Chief of Naval Operations John Richardson has directed an “out of cycle” housing survey be given to all Sailors currently living in the housing.

The intent of the survey, which will be conducted from April 2-30 by an independent third party, is to determine residents’ overall satisfaction with privatized housing, to include health and safety concerns.
